Prefab splint

Has anyone tried using a prefab splint? Dr. Eaton suggests using a wrist splint designed for the opposite hand and turning it upside down. I can't seem to find one that would work well this way. Any ideas? Or anyone found an inexpensive splint made specifically for Dupuytren's?
